Job Description
Welding Engineering & Control
• Develop, review, and maintain Welding Procedure Specifications (WPS), Procedure Qualification Records (PQR), and Welding Qualification Records (WQTR).
• Ensure welding activities comply with applicable codes and standards such as AWS, ASME, API, ISO, and DNV.
• Select appropriate welding processes (SMAW, GTAW, GMAW, FCAW, SAW) based on material and application.
• Provide technical guidance to supervisors and welders on welding techniques and procedures.

Fabrication Yard Support
• Support fabrication activities including fit?up, welding, repair welding, and distortion control.
• Assist in resolving welding?related production issues and non?conformities.
• Ensure proper pre?heat, interpass temperature, post?weld heat treatment (PWHT), and consumable control.
• Coordinate welding activities during trial assemblies and offshore structure modules fabrication.
